高校宿舍管理系统Word下载.docx

上传人:b****5 文档编号:19094851 上传时间:2023-01-03 格式:DOCX 页数:35 大小:1.95MB
下载 相关 举报
高校宿舍管理系统Word下载.docx_第1页
第1页 / 共35页
高校宿舍管理系统Word下载.docx_第2页
第2页 / 共35页
高校宿舍管理系统Word下载.docx_第3页
第3页 / 共35页
高校宿舍管理系统Word下载.docx_第4页
第4页 / 共35页
高校宿舍管理系统Word下载.docx_第5页
第5页 / 共35页
点击查看更多>>
下载资源
资源描述

高校宿舍管理系统Word下载.docx

《高校宿舍管理系统Word下载.docx》由会员分享,可在线阅读,更多相关《高校宿舍管理系统Word下载.docx(35页珍藏版)》请在冰豆网上搜索。

高校宿舍管理系统Word下载.docx

2.1技术可行性3

2.2经济可行性3

2.3操作可行性3

2.4法律可行性4

第3章需求分析5

3.1业务流程5

3.1.1基础数据5

3.1.2信息维护5

3.1.3查询浏览6

3.2需求规范6

3.2.1产品背景6

3.2.2产品概述7

3.2.3功能需求7

3.2.4性能需求8

3.2.5系统逻辑模型8

3.3数据字典10

3.3.1数据元素定义10

3.3.2数据流的定义12

3.3.3数据存储定义13

3.3.4数据处理定义14

第4章概要设计15

4.1系统运行总体流程15

4.2目标系统体系结构16

4.2.1高校宿舍管理系统软件结构图16

4.2.2登陆权限模块结构图16

4.2.3基础数据模块结构图16

4.2.4信息维护模块结构图17

4.2.5查询浏览模块结构图17

第5章数据库设计18

5.1数据库逻辑设计18

5.2数据库关系设计21

第6章详细设计22

6.1登录窗口设计22

6.2学生查课页面设计24

6.3教师查课页面设计25

6.4年级管理页面设计25

6.5学生管理页面设计26

6.6教师管理页面设计26

6.7课程管理页面设计27

6.8管理员管理页面设计27

6.9智能排课页面设计28

6.10自定义排课页面设计29

6.11展示页面设计30

第7章系统测试32

7.1软件测试基础理论32

7.2系统转换与实现33

7.3系统的优点及技术特征33

7.4系统的不足及改进方案33

7.5系统的运行与维护33

结论34

致谢35

参考文献36

附录A37

附录B39

第1章绪论

1.1系统开发背景

数据库是从60年代初发展起来的计算机技术。

经过四十来年的发展,数据库技术己经趋于成熟。

数据库在新的计算机环境中发生了很大的变化。

就数据应用而言呈现出多样化的空间,如数字图书馆、电子出版物、电子商务、远程教育系统等的出现,给数据库技术提出了更多、更高的要求。

随着科学技术的不断提高,计算机科学日渐成熟,其强大的功能已为人们深刻认识,它已进入人类社会的各个领域并发挥着越来越重要的作用。

作为计算机应用的一部分,使用计算机对宿舍进行管理,有着手工管理所无法比拟的优点。

例如:

检索迅速、查找方便、可靠性高、存储量大、保密性好、寿命长、成本低等。

这些优点能够极大地提高人事劳资管理的效率,也是企业的科学化、正规化管理,与世界接轨的重要条件。

1.2系统开发方法及目标

以各高校的宿舍管理需求为应用背景,开发一个典型的高校宿舍管理系统。

考虑实际情况,本系统将采用结构化生命周期法进行系统分析和设计,并采用原型法进行系统实施。

这样能有效避免盲目开发问题,同时能充分的发挥原型法的优势,能顺利实现系统的实施。

高校宿舍管理系统可以用于支持各高校完成宿舍的管理,有如下几个个方面的目标:

宿舍的基本信息:

地点、位置、楼层、面积、标准人数、内部设置、收费标准、类别等;

班级基本信息:

专业、年级、人数、辅导员、班长等;

学生基本信息:

年龄、性别等。

具体设计功能如下:

1、界面友好,操作简单,帮您轻松上手。

2、系统具有灵活、严格的权限设定功能,采用非常周密有效的权限设置,确保企业各类资料的可靠性和保密性,防止错误和违规操作。

系统管理:

可修改管理员权限及密码。

3、能对基本信息进行插入、删除、修改等操作。

完成宿舍的学生住宿分配,可以自动分配或手动分配。

数据查询:

按宿舍、专业、年级、班级、学生等进行分类查询,能进行精确和模糊查询

4、友善的登录界面

5、退出系统:

第2章可行性分析

2.1技术可行性

该系统对软、硬件系统要求较低,所需硬件设备,市场上销售且价格较低,甚至可以使用原有的设备。

软件上,操作系统采用Windows系列操作系统、MicrosoftVisualStudio2005作为前台开发工具,它具有的“编辑后继续运行(editandcontinue)”的特性,超越了旧的编辑—编译—测试模式。

它还引入了面向对象的程序设计思想和“控件”概念,使得大量已经编好的C#程序可以直接拿来使用。

同时, 

C#又是最容易学习与应用的程序语言之一。

它的功能非常强大,已成为一种专业化的开发语言和环境。

采用SQLServer2000作为后台数据库平台的管理系统,它在电子商务、数据仓库和数据库解决方案等应用中起着核心作用,可为企业的数据管理提供强大的支持,对数据库中的数据提供有效的管理,并采用有效的措施实现数据的完整性、数据的安全性以及数据的可靠易用性等等。

这些软件在高校宿舍管理系统开发中已被大量应用,技术上都比较成熟。

因此在技术上是可行的。

2.2经济可行性

当今学校内部没有完善的高校宿舍管理系统,管理水平差,宿舍不能得到合理分配,学生,教师管理档案问题重重。

迫切需要提高现代化管理水平、管理质量和管理高校课程。

高校宿舍管理系统的初步现代化的开发和使用,能够大大提高学校管理者的工作效率,节省成本提高经济效益。

它把从事人力资源管理的人员从繁重的手工操作中解脱出来,用更多精力从事创造性的管理活动和其它重要的活动中去,从而达到节省人力、物力,财力的目标;

它能使决策、计划和其它管理活动更加科学、精确、灵活。

因此,开发一个专门针对高校宿舍管理系统,在经济上也是可行的。

2.3操作可行性

本系统灵活方便,快捷迅速,适应处理多项数据。

采用友好、直观的视窗界面,鼠标、键盘两种操作方式任意选择,方便快捷。

界面统一规范,提示信息功能完整,稍一接触就可以上手进行所有操作。

2.4法律可行性

本系统纯为个人设计,在开发过程中没有涉及合同、责任、版权等与国家相关法律规定相抵触的方面。

因此,本系统在法律上是可行的。

第3章需求分析

3.1业务流程

在系统开发总体任务的基础上完成系统功能分析。

系统开发的总体任务一般由学校管理人员提出。

高校宿舍管理系统对学校学生的信息管理,主要实现如下的一些功能:

楼房管理,添加楼房,修改楼房,删除楼房。

房间管理,房间录入,房间信息修改,房间删除。

班级管理,班级录入,班级信息修改,班级删除。

宿舍管理,住宿情况查看,办理人员入住,办理迁出。

信息查询,人物查询,房间查询。

数据统计,人物统计,房间统计。

迁出记录,查看迁出信息,查看口人是否迁出。

3.1.1基础数据

在整体设计中,我们将宿舍管理系统分为六个大的模块:

楼房管理模块、宿舍管理模块、班级管理模块、学生管理模块、信息查询功能模块和信息统计功能模块。

每个模块将实现不同的功能。

3.1.2信息维护

对宿舍,学生信息等进行维护,可对已存在的信息进行修改与删除操作,避免由于工作失误造成的信息录入错误,及时更改存储数据中存在的不足之处,使管理者时刻可以接收到第一手的变动资料,便于对学校宿舍的管理。

3.1.3查询浏览

根据输入的查询条件,快速、准确的找到并浏览符合条件的学生,宿舍,或管理员,此模块拥有检索迅速、查找方便、可靠性高、存储量大、保密性好、寿命长、成本低的优点,可以极大地提高人学生查宿舍的效率,也是学校走向科学化、正规化管理,与世界接轨的重要条件。

3.2需求规范

3.2.1产品背景

随着计算机技术的飞速发展,特别是计算机的应用已普及到经济和社会生活的各个领域。

使原本的旧的管理方法越来越不适应现在社会的发展。

许多人还停留在以前的手工操作。

这大大地阻碍了人类经济的发展。

为了适应现代社会人们高度强烈的时间观念,利用计算机实现高校宿舍管理系统势在必行。

对于各大高校来说,利用计算机支持学校的学生,教师查课,管理员排课,是适应现代学校的制度要求、推动学校管理走向科学化、系统化、规范化的必要条件,从而达到提高校管理效率的目的。

给同学和老师带来方便。

在计算机硬件和软件快速发展的今天,计算机硬件和软件已经远远满足本管理系统的要求。

在数据库编程工具方面,各种可视化编程方法的出现,一改过去程序设计的概念和方法,用户用鼠标就可以快速、简捷地创建应用程序,极大地提高了编程效率。

选用MicrosoftVisualStudio2005中文版数据库开发的应用程序可以独立运行于windows平台,而且SQLServer2000产生的数据库(表)适用范围广,因此本系统采用MicrosoftVisualStudio2005中文版来完成高校宿舍管理系统的设计。

3.2.2产品概述

这是一套通用性很强的高校宿舍管理系统,有以下功能:

运行环境:

硬件配置:

CPU:

奔腾Ⅲ800M以上

硬盘:

至少100M空间及以上

内存:

64M以上

打印机:

可选。

软件配置:

操作系统:

WIN98/WinNT/Win2000/WinXP/WinVista等系统上。

编译环境:

采用MicrosoftVisualStudio2005作为前台开发工具,SQLServer2000作为后台数据库平台。

3.2.3功能需求

计算机在高校宿舍管理系统中的作用有:

计算机能够比人更快更好地提供有信息价值的安排宿舍等数据;

其主要功能需求可以归纳为以下三点:

一是易操作,这点看起来简单,但是非常重要,也是所有企业都注重的一个需求。

学校不是软件公司,所以很难找出精通电脑的人才,如果您做的软件过于复杂的话,那么由谁来操作呢?

所以我做程序首先考虑的是易操作。

二是切合实际性,好刀用在刀刃上,我做这个系统第二个考虑的就是实用性,此系统并没有什么花哨的功能,也没有鸡肋功能,所有的功能都是学校宿舍管理正好能用的上的,这样即节省了开发时间,又提高了系统的工作效率,还易操作,真是一举三得。

三是可以提供各种加工处理后的学生信息,以满足高校宿舍管理系统的特殊要求,适应新形势对宿舍管理系统提出的新要求,帮助选择方案,实现优化决策。

当前,不少单位的人事部门对于计算机的应用还仅限于简单的单机应用,随着时间的推移、任务的复杂、用户的需求,其应用还会逐步发展为网络化、信息化。

3.2.4性能需求

从理论上讲系统的性能需求包括:

1、系统的吞吐量:

是在给定时间段内系统完成的交易数量。

即系统的吞吐量越大,说明系统在单位时间内完成的用户或系统请求越多,系统的资源得到充分利用。

2、响应时间:

事务从终端输入,以按下回车键开始计时,到开始从屏幕上显示结果为止所用的时间,至于显示结果所用的时间不计算在内。

通常在线系统要规定系统的响应时间指标。

3、可靠性:

有一个稳定可靠的系统是确保整个系统正常运行的关键。

4、安全性:

计算机系统的数据不受非授权用户存取的能力。

整个系统不应由于操作失误,甚至恶意攻击而遭到破坏。

系统的安全性能可由操作系统的口令设备以及数据库系统的视图管理设备提供。

本系统的性能需求能够满足以上要求,具有系统吞吐量大、响应时间短、可靠性与安全行强的优点。

对所有登录本系统的使用用户进行严格的用户名和密码的管理,如果不属于系统事先设定好的合法用户,则系统无法登录,为了防止密码外泄,本系统具备密码修改功能。

3.2.5系统逻辑模型

数据流程图描述数据流动、存储、处理的逻辑关系,也称为逻辑数据流程图,一般用DFD(DataFlowDiagram)表示。

它有抽象性和概括性两个特性。

它是一个分层的模型工具,它分为3个层次:

总体图、零级图和细节图,分别描述系统的不同特征。

数据流程图使用4种图形符号,表示为:

外部实体数据处理数据流数据存储

图3.1数据流程图图例

图3.2高校宿舍管理系统总体图

图3.3高校宿舍管理系统零级图

图3.4高校宿舍管理系统细节图

3.3数据字典

数据流图表达了数据和处理的关系,数据字典则是系统中各类数据描述、数据信息定义的集合,是进行详细的数据收集和数据分析所获得的主要成果。

数据字典对数据流程图中的数据成分进行细化说明,详尽地描述了数据本身特性及处理和存储情况。

描述了软件系统中使用的或产生的每一个数据元素,通常包括数据项、数据结构、数据流、数据存储和处理过程五个部分,其中数据项是数据的最小组成单位,若干个数据项可以组成一个数据结构。

数据字典通过对数据项和数据结构的定义来描述数据流、数据存储的逻辑内容,是数据库设计的依据,是软件工程中的需求分析阶段中的重要成果,在数据库设计中占有很重要的地位。

绘制DFD,只是对数据处理和彼此之间的联系进行了说明。

为进一步明确数据的详细内容和数据加工过程,应将数据流图中的全部数据流及其组成部分的数据元素,数据存储,数据加工,通过数据字典描述清楚,以便于此后系统设计的进行。

这就需要开发人员编写详细的数据字典,来描述系统开发过程的细节。

限于篇幅,下面列出了本系统中数据元素、数据流、数据存储、数据处理、和外部项的DD的例子。

3.3.1数据元素定义

数据元素即数据项,是不可再分的数据单位,它全面、详尽地刻画了数据流中的数据元素的取值情况、被处理情况以及存储情况。

对数据项的描述通常包括以下内容:

数据项描述={数据项名,数据项含义说明,别名,数据类型,长度,取值范围,取值含义,与其它数据项的逻辑关系,数据项之间的关系}

其中“取值范围”、“与其它数据项的逻辑关系”(例如该数据项等于另几个数据项的和,该数据项值等于另一数据项的值等)定义了数据的完整性约束条件,是设计数据检验功能的依据。

数据元素是软件系统中最小数据元素,它是构成数据库以及系统模块间交换数据的最小单元。

下表数据元素定义包括:

数据元素名称、含义说明、相关文件或记录、简述、数据特征等。

表3.1数据元素定义表

序号

数据元素名称

数据元素含义说明

相关文件或记录

简述

数据特征

1

buildingid

宿舍楼ID

building

唯一标识,不可重复

类型:

int

长度:

8

2

administrator

管理员姓名

char

3

flooramount

宿舍高度

宿舍楼层

varchar

10

4

areamount

宿舍面积

12

5

buildingsex

宿舍学生性别

nvarchar

6

studentid

学生号

student

学生的学号

20

7

studentname

学生姓名

10

8

studentsex

学生性别

9

outtime

退学时间

Out

date

Reason

退出理由

50

3.3.2数据流的定义

数据流是数据结构在系统内传输的路径。

通常对数据流的描述通常包括以下内容:

数据流描述={数据流名,说明,数据流来源,数据流去向,组成:

{数据结构},平均流量,高峰期流量}

其中“数据流来源”是说明该数据流来自哪个过程。

“数据流去向”是说明该数据流将到哪个过程去。

“平均流量”是指在单位时间(每天、每周、每月等)里的传输次数。

“高峰期流量”则是指在高峰时期的数据流量。

数据流是外部实体和系统之间及系统内部处理之间进

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 求职职场 > 简历

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1